How can I make relation among smallworld circuits in FME

Hi everyone,

I have a good question that I tried to achieved but this is very difficult for me.

I have circuits in the smallworld database. This circuits have got a simple parent-child relationship. There are many circuits like this but there is no relation first circuit with 3th circuit. If I accept the first circuit is a parent, this parent related downstream circuit mean that its own child circuit. However this parent circuit doesn't have relation with its own child's downstream circuits.

I would like to make a relation among from first circuit to end....

 

I have got circuit_line as shape format and the related internal table as excel in the attached

You can consider and start from this parent id 46598749 circuit id =5018-OG-6002

Could you use the PathBuilder (and generate a list from circuits it finds) or the ShortestPathFinder transformers?

Not sure, but we usually use Magik code in Smallworld for this kind of calculations.
